Case summary
A resident of Omsk Region. A criminal case was initiated against him on charges of disseminating knowingly false information about the Armed Forces of the Russian Federation. On May 27, 2024, Tyurin was sentenced to 6 years’ imprisonment in a general-regime penal colony. On February 20, 2024, Tyurin was added to the Rosfinmonitoring List of Terrorists and Extremists with a designation applied to persons prosecuted under terrorism-related articles. It later became known that a criminal case had also been initiated against him on charges of the public justification of terrorism. In the same month, he was sentenced to 4 years’ imprisonment in a general-regime penal colony. In addition, a criminal case was initiated against Tyurin on charges of discrediting the Armed Forces of the Russian Federation. On October 3, 2024, he was sentenced in this case to 1 year’s imprisonment in a general-regime penal colony. Furthermore, Tyurin was charged with calls for activities directed against the security of the Russian Federation and with repeated demonstration of prohibited symbols; the details are unknown. On November 18, 2024, he was sentenced in this case, with the aggregate sentence, taking into account the three previous convictions, amounting to 6 years 6 months’ imprisonment in a general-regime penal colony. On February 17, 2025, Tyurin died in custody.
